Operatory jednoargumentowe
W wyrażeniech wielowymiarowych (MDX), operatory jednoargumentowe wykonują operacje na pojedynczym operandzie, na przykład zwracają ujemną lub dodatnią wartość z wyrażenie liczbowe.
MDX obsługuje operatory jednoargumentowe wymienione w poniższej tabela.
Operator |
Opis |
|---|---|
Zwraca wartość ujemną wyrażenie liczbowe. |
|
Zwraca wartość dodatnią wyrażenie liczbowe. |
Poniższy przykład ilustruje użycie operator jednoargumentowego zwraca wartość ujemną miara:
WITH
MEMBER [Measures].[NegDiscountAmount] AS
-[Measures].[Discount Amount]
SELECT
{[Measures].[Discount Amount],[Measures].[NegDiscountAmount]} on COLUMNS,
NON EMPTY [Product].[Product].MEMBERS ON Rows
FROM [Adventure Works]
WHERE [Product].[Category].[Bikes]
Ponadto MDX używa operatory jednoargumentowe specjalnych, aby określić operację agregacja, wykonywane przez RollupChildren funkcja.Więcej informacji na temat tych operatory jednoargumentowe specjalnych, zobacz Dodawanie agregacji niestandardowe do wymiaru.